(CHICAGO) There’s a big political story today at the Cook County Board.
After decades of debate, the County Board has voted to put a referendum on the November ballot asking you if the archaic Recorder of Deeds office should be merged into the Cook County Clerk’s office beginning in 2020.
Chief sponsor of the move is County Board member John Fritchey.
“I think a lot of elected officials still look at their offices as personal thiefdoms. That mentality is no longer tolerated by the public. So, the time is right for the voters, the time is right for the board, so let’s just say that it was the perfect storm for reform,” said Fritchey.
And the time was right because political patronage isn’t what it used to be.
